Filing History
IRS 990 filing history for Second Hand Purrs Shelter showing financial trends over 13 years of public records:
Over 13 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2023), Second Hand Purrs Shelter's revenue has grown by 151.1%, moving from $129K to $325K. Total assets increased by 768.7% over the same period, from $17K to $147K. Total functional expenses rose by 85.1%, from $123K to $229K. In its most recent filing year (2023), Second Hand Purrs Shelter reported a surplus of $96K, with revenue exceeding expenses.

IRS 990 forms are annual information returns that most tax-exempt organizations must file with the IRS. These forms provide detailed financial information including revenue, expenses, assets, liabilities, and compensation of officers.
